Description
4-Ethoxycarbonyl-3-Methoxyphenylboronic Acid is a specialized boronic acid derivative that serves as a crucial building block in modern synthetic chemistry. Its value lies in its dual functional groups, enabling it to act as a versatile coupling partner in cross-coupling reactions, such as the Suzuki-Miyaura reaction, to construct complex molecular architectures. This high-purity intermediate is essential for researchers and manufacturers in the pharmaceutical and agrochemical industries, particularly in the development of active ingredients and advanced materials.

Basic Information
| Product Name | 4-Ethoxycarbonyl-3-Methoxyphenylboronic Acid |
| CAS No. | 911312-76-0 |
| Molecular Formula | C10H13BO5 |
| Molecular Weight | 224.02 g/mol |
| Synonyms | (4-(Ethoxycarbonyl)-3-methoxyphenyl)boronic acid; 3-Methoxy-4-(ethoxycarbonyl)benzeneboronic acid; 4-Carbethoxy-3-methoxyphenylboronic Acid; Boronic acid, B-[4-(ethoxycarbonyl)-3-methoxyphenyl]-; 911312-76-0; 4-Ethoxycarbonyl-3-methoxybenzeneboronic acid |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(15-25°C). This compound is hygroscopic (moisture-sensitive) and must be kept under an inert atmosphere (e.g., nitrogen or argon) for long-term storage to prevent degradation.
